Transaction 5dfa8e7a607bbf7d9594941fb12d2f51825c7585471c206350bb56de8fa3a1cd
1 Input
1 Output
-
5dfa8e7a607bbf7d9594941fb12d2f51825c7585471c206350bb56de8fa3a1cd:0
- value
- 743698
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8507d61b5bca4d4f43abc67a5382c98099f43d47 OP_EQUAL
- address
- 3DpRBY5fq2pvBd5dE7vFNPzmGwhAgtrB7F